Canada steadies Turkish rebar exports after Asia-shipment slump

Turkish rebar exports declined -9% on-year in March to 540,683 tonnes, despite Canada alone taking 117,080t compared to zero in March 2017, according to Turkish Statistical Institute (TUIK) data monitored by Kallanish. The US was the second-largest export market, increasing intake over eight-fold in March to 85,767t, on the eve of Section 232 tariff implementation.
